摘要
采用正确的光谱预处理方法,选择合适的光谱区域,用偏最小二乘回归确定定量校正模型,建立了近红外光谱测定航空煤油馏程、密度、冰点、闪点的方法。实验结果表明:采用近红外光谱分析航空煤油,分析数据均能达到标准方法的误差要求,能够满足化验和生产需求。
The quantitative calibration model was confirmed by partial least square regression with proper spectral region selected by correct spectrum pretreatment method.The method of determining distillation range,density,freezing point and flash point of aviation kerosene by near-infrared spectroscopy(NIRS)is established.The experimental results show that the analysis data of aviation kerosene by near-infared spectroscopy can meet the error requirements of standard method and meet the needs of laboratory test and production.
